8月新能源车企销量普涨,多个品牌同比翻倍
经济观察报· 2025-09-04 12:07
Core Viewpoint - The article highlights the strong sales performance of various new energy vehicle companies in August, with many experiencing significant year-on-year growth, while traditional automakers also showed positive trends, except for a few exceptions [2][4]. New Energy Vehicle Companies - In the new car manufacturing sector, all companies except Li Auto and Zeekr showed growth, with some brands achieving over 100% year-on-year increase [2][4]. - Leap Motor led the new car manufacturers with an August delivery of 57,000 units, an 88% increase year-on-year, and a cumulative sales of 329,000 units from January to August, marking a 136% increase [3][4]. - Xiaopeng Motors reported a strong performance with 38,000 units sold in August, a 169% increase, and a total of 272,000 units sold from January to August, reflecting a 252% increase [4][5]. - NIO also saw a recovery with 31,000 units sold in August, a 55% increase, supported by new models like the L90 [4][5]. - Li Auto's sales were 29,000 units in August, down 41% year-on-year, and a total of 263,000 units from January to August, down 9% [4][5]. Traditional Automakers - Among traditional automakers, BYD maintained its leading position with 374,000 units sold in August, showing a slight increase of 0.1% year-on-year [7][8]. - Geely's sales reached 147,000 units in August, a 95% increase, while Changan and Chery also reported significant growth of 80% and 53%, respectively [8][9]. - GAC Aion experienced a decline of 24% in August sales, but future performance is anticipated to improve due to ongoing reforms within GAC Group [9].

新造车8月销量出炉:零跑继续领跑,蔚来创新高
Bei Jing Shang Bao· 2025-09-02 10:28
Core Viewpoint - The new energy vehicle market in China continues to thrive, with several new force car manufacturers reporting impressive sales figures in August, indicating a competitive landscape and the need for differentiation among products [2][3][7]. Group 1: Sales Performance - Leap Motor led the sales with 57,066 units delivered in August, achieving a year-on-year growth of over 88% and marking the second consecutive month of sales exceeding 50,000 units [2][3]. - Hongmeng Zhixing delivered 44,579 units, with a year-on-year increase of 32.3%, although it experienced a slight month-on-month decline of 1.8% [3][4]. - Xiaopeng Motors reported 37,709 units delivered, reflecting a significant year-on-year growth of 168.7% and a month-on-month increase of 2.7% [2][3]. - NIO delivered 31,305 units, marking a year-on-year growth of 55.2% and achieving a historical high in sales [3][4]. - Ideal Auto saw a decline in deliveries, with 28,500 units sold, falling below the 30,000 mark for the first time in three months [4]. Group 2: Market Trends - The overall sales of new energy vehicles reached approximately 1.1 million units in August, with a penetration rate of 56.7% in the narrow passenger vehicle market [7]. - The growth in the new energy vehicle sector is driven by the replacement of fuel vehicles and policies encouraging trade-ins [7]. - The market is characterized by a degree of instability, with some companies struggling to establish a stable brand image among consumers [7][8]. Group 3: Factors Influencing Sales - The success of new models significantly impacted sales, with vehicles like Leap B01 and Xiaopeng's new P7 receiving substantial market attention [5][6]. - Competitive pricing and technological advancements are key drivers for sales growth, with Leap Motor covering a price range of 60,000 to 200,000 yuan [5][7]. - Production capacity remains a critical factor, as some brands face limitations despite having sufficient orders, prompting investments in capacity expansion [6][8]. Group 4: Industry Challenges - New energy vehicle manufacturers face challenges such as insufficient production flexibility and tight cash flow [8]. - There is a noted issue of product homogeneity among new force car manufacturers, necessitating a focus on differentiation, particularly in vehicle stability and safety [8].

比亚迪8月销量达37.36万辆,新能源累计突破1340万辆
Jing Ji Guan Cha Bao· 2025-09-01 13:34
Group 1 - BYD reported global sales of 373,626 vehicles in August, with passenger car sales reaching 371,501, maintaining its leadership in the global electric vehicle market [2] - Cumulative sales from January to August 2025 reached 2,863,876 vehicles, showing significant year-on-year growth [2] - Since entering the new energy sector, BYD's total global sales have surpassed 13.4 million vehicles, further solidifying its industry-leading position [2] Group 2 - The overseas market has become a crucial growth engine, with 80,464 passenger cars and pickups sold internationally in August, representing a substantial year-on-year increase of 146.4% [2] - Cumulative overseas sales from January to August reached 630,728 vehicles, indicating an accelerated internationalization process [2]
财报季|比亚迪上半年营收利润均增,但二季度表现不佳
Guan Cha Zhe Wang· 2025-09-01 08:49
Core Viewpoint - BYD has shown strong performance in the first half of 2025, but faces challenges in the domestic market, while opportunities in overseas markets are expected to increase in the second half [1][4]. Financial Performance - In the first half of 2025, BYD's revenue was approximately 371.28 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 23.3%, and the net profit attributable to shareholders was about 15.51 billion yuan, up 13.79% [1][2]. - The second quarter revenue reached 200.92 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 14.04%, but the net profit for the same period was 6.36 billion yuan, a decline of 29.87% [2]. - The gross profit margin in the second quarter was 16.3%, showing a decline both year-on-year and quarter-on-quarter [2]. Sales and Market Position - BYD's total sales of new energy vehicles in the first half of 2025 reached 2.146 million units, a year-on-year increase of 33.03%, with overseas sales exceeding 470,000 units, up 132% [2][5]. - As of June 30, 2025, BYD ranked 7th globally in vehicle sales, surpassing Honda and Nissan, marking the highest ranking for a Chinese automaker [2]. Operational Challenges - BYD's operating capital gap was 122.7 billion yuan as of June 30, 2025, an increase from 95.8 billion yuan at the end of the first quarter [3]. - The asset-liability ratio was 71.08%, up from 70.7% at the end of the first quarter [3]. - Domestic sales have shown a declining trend for three consecutive months, with July production dropping to 317,900 units, a year-on-year decrease of 0.92%, marking the first negative growth in 17 months [2]. Future Outlook - BYD aims to expand its product line and enhance its overseas production capacity and sales network in the second half of 2025 [5]. - The company has set a global sales target of 5.5 million units for the year, with a current completion rate of approximately 45.28% as of July [3].
